Council to host Australia Day nomination workshops

Do you know someone who deserves to be acknowledged for the contribution they make to the Griffith community, but aren't sure how to go about nominating them for an Australia Day Award?

Council will hold two workshops to help locals understand the process involved in lodging an Australia Day nomination form.

The workshops will be held on Thursday, 31 October 2019 at 1pm and again on Thursday, 21 November at 5pm at Griffith City Council.

Nominations are open in the following categories:

  • Environmental Citizen of the Year (new category)
  • Community Project of the Year
  • Citizen of the Year
  • Young Citizen of the Year
  • Junior Citizen
  • Sportsperson
  • Young Sportsperson
  • Club Person
  • Sports Team

Please note: Council has included a new category this year, the Environmental Citizen of the Year.

This award recognises outstanding efforts by individuals or organisations to preserve the environment, reduce litter and improve recycling, or use the Return and Earn scheme in an innovative way to fundraise for a meaningful cause.
